First printing of Kerouac’s collected writings on travel: on foot, by railway, aboard ship and on the road.
Collected journal entries, both previously published and unpublished, by Kerouac who had “nothing else to do but roam, long-faced, the real America, with my unreal heart.” Connected by the common theme of traveling, Lonesome Traveler ranges over not only the length and breadth of the United States but “Mexico, Morocco, Paris, London, both the Atlantic and the Pacific oceans at sea in ships, and various and interesting people and cities therein included."
